The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Richard Divall, born in 1802 in Burwash, Sussex, consisted of 3 members. Richard was the head of the household, widower. He had 1 child; Ann, born 1826 in Burwash, Sussex, England.
During the period, also present in the household was Richard's Visitor, Laura Divall, born in 1866 in United States.
